Inventory Shrinkage from Manual Measurement Errors

1 verified sources

Definition

When multiple operators take tank readings using different techniques or equipment, measurement variations create substantial discrepancies in inventory reconciliation. These losses remain hidden until end-of-period reconciliation, delaying detection and remediation.

Key Findings

  • Financial Impact: Up to 3% of inventory value in unexplained losses; millions annually per facility
  • Frequency: Detected during monthly/periodic reconciliation cycles
  • Root Cause: Manual measurement variations from inconsistent operator techniques and equipment; lack of real-time automated monitoring
